About
The TH-31 is a space engine from the Tianhuo series, developed by Space Pioneer (Tianbing Technology). It uses room-temperature liquid propellants and is suitable for spacecraft orbit changes and attitude control. The engine features a bipropellant pressure-fed system, using dinitrogen tetroxide/monomethylhydrazine (NTO/MMH) as propellants. It boasts a vacuum thrust of 3000N + 8*150N and a vacuum specific impulse of 310s. The TH-31 is designed for multiple starts, with a minimum of 2 starts and up to 2000 starts, and offers quick start acceleration of ≤0.3s. Its shortest working time is 0.5s, with a minimum working interval of 50ms, and a maximum continuous working time of 750s.
